Timeline

The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.

  • 2022-02-07 First Reading introduction, reading-1
  • 2022-02-07 Authored by Representative Wallace
  • 2022-02-08 Second Reading referred to Rules reading-2, referral-committee
  • 2022-02-09 Withdrawn from Rules Committee
  • 2022-02-09 Referred to Appropriations and Budget referral-committee
  • 2022-03-03 CR; Do Pass, amended by committee substitute Appropriations and Budget Committee committee-passage
  • 2022-03-03 Coauthored by Representative(s) Dempsey
  • 2022-03-03 Authored by Senator Howard (principal Senate author)
  • 2022-03-09 General Order
  • 2022-03-09 Third Reading, Measure passed: Ayes: 87 Nays: 6 passage, reading-3
  • 2022-03-09 Referred for engrossment
  • 2022-03-10 Engrossed, signed, to Senate passage
  • 2022-03-10 First Reading introduction, reading-1
  • 2022-03-24 Second Reading referred to Finance Committee then to Appropriations Committee reading-2, referral-committee
  • 2022-04-06 Coauthored by Representative Lowe (Dick)
  • 2022-04-07 Reported Do Pass, amended by committee substitute Finance committee; CR filed committee-passage
  • 2022-04-07 Referred to Appropriations referral-committee
  • 2022-04-13 Reported Do Pass, amended by committee substitute Appropriations committee; CR filed committee-passage
  • 2022-04-13 Title stricken
  • 2022-04-13 Coauthored by Senator Jech
  • 2022-04-27 General Order, Amended
  • 2022-04-27 Measure passed: Ayes: 33 Nays: 11 passage
  • 2022-04-27 Referred for engrossment
  • 2022-04-27 Coauthored by Senator Kirt
  • 2022-04-28 Engrossed to House passage
  • 2022-04-28 SA's received
  • 2022-05-04 SA's rejected, conference requested, naming GCCA
  • 2022-05-05 Conference granted, GCCA
  • 2022-05-19 CCR submitted
  • 2022-05-19 Title restored
  • 2022-05-20 CCR adopted
  • 2022-05-20 Fourth Reading, Measure passed: Ayes: 67 Nays: 6 passage
  • 2022-05-20 To Senate
  • 2022-05-20 CCR read
  • 2022-05-20 CCR adopted
  • 2022-05-20 Measure passed, to House: Ayes: 36 Nays: 7 passage
  • 2022-05-20 Referred for enrollment
  • 2022-05-20 Enrolled, signed, to Senate
  • 2022-05-20 Enrolled measure signed, returned to House
  • 2022-05-20 Sent to Governor executive-receipt
  • 2022-05-26 Approved by Governor 05/26/2022 executive-signature
